Spanish auxiliary chair designed by Pierre Lottier for Almazan, 1950s. Oak wood structure with curved and harmonious lines where the reddish-brown leather back rests with metal studs. This chair became very popular in Spain in the 1950s thanks to the design of the French interior designer Pierre Lottier, who settled in Barcelona, for the Spanish brands Valenti, Valmazan and Almazan, which made various versions of this chair and other seats and footrest of the same style, always using oak wood and leather as the only materials. At the base you can see the Almazan seal (see last photo). Nice patina. Very good condition, with minimal signs of use.
